Robert Parker rated the 2004 Insignia 94-96 points on his 100-point scale and said: "The soft, opulent 2004 Insignia (a 10,000-case blend of 72% Cabernet Sauvignon, 14% Merlot, 12% Petit Verdot, and 2% Malbec) is already seductive and lush. Offering abundant quantities of cassis, incense, graphite, plums, blackberries, and black currants, it will be hard to resist young, but should age effortlessly for two decades or more."
His opinion of the 2004 Backus is just as flattering - 95 points and: "Made in a sexy, seductive, flamboyant style, the 2004 Cabernet Sauvignon Backus Vineyard includes small amounts of Petit Verdot and Malbec in the blend. An inky/purple color is followed by a big, opulent, full-throttle bouquet of graphite, blackberries, and acacia flowers. With fabulous fruit purity, richness, and a savory, expansive, full-bodied mouthfeel, it should provide immense pleasure over the next two decades."
